Key midfielder Craig Bryson is a concern for Derby ahead of the second leg of Sunday's Championship play-off semi-final against Brighton at the iPro Stadium.
Bryson, the Rams' player of the year, took a whack to his back towards the end of Thursday night's 2-1 first-leg win on the south coast, but boss Steve McClaren expects him to be available.
Club captain Shaun Barker (knee), fellow defender James O'Connor (thigh) and midfielder Paul Coutts (knee) remain long-term absentees.
But McClaren otherwise has no new injury concerns as he bids to take the Rams one step closer to promotion back to the Premier League.
Brighton have new injury concerns over Matt Upson and Will Buckley ahead of the second leg.
The Seagulls have to overturn a one-goal deficit to reach the final but they may have to do it without centre-half Upson, who has been carrying an ankle injury recently and finished the first leg in pain again.
Winger Buckley will also be checked over after he came off at half-time with a tight hamstring.
Midfielders Dale Stephens (ankle) and Andrew Crofts (knee) miss out again but right-back Bruno could return after a groin injury kept him sidelined at the Amex.
